About Patricia Valdes

Raised in Lake Geneva, Wisconsin, this real estate professional holds a Bachelor of Arts degree in Latin American Area Studies from Denison University in Granville, Ohio. Following graduation, they relocated to The Ocean Reef Club in Key Largo, Florida, where they took on the unique roles of lifeguard and dolphin trainer, performing two shows daily.

After spending seven years back in Wisconsin, they settled in the Vero Beach area in 1984. Since becoming a licensed Realtor in 1990, they have gained extensive experience across various facets of the real estate market, including development projects at Grand Harbor, The Seasons, and Indian River Club, as well as serving as a buyer's agent for 15 years.

This agent is a proud parent of two: Mandy, an art teacher at the Imagine School in Vero Beach, and Bo, who works in real estate in St. Petersburg, Florida. They also have a grandson, Drew, who is 13 and will be entering the eighth grade at the Imagine School, having made a memorable entrance during Hurricane Frances.

In addition to their professional pursuits, they enjoy a range of hobbies, including cooking, farming, boating, fishing, swimming, biking, gardening, and baking.

Major Indian River County, Florida Real Estate Markets

Vero Beach dominates the county's real estate landscape, serving as both the county seat and the primary hub for luxury coastal living. The city's barrier island communities, including Riomar and John's Island, consistently rank among Florida's most exclusive residential areas, while the mainland offers more accessible options in neighborhoods like Indian River Shores and Windsor. Sebastian, the county's northern anchor, has emerged as a surprising hotspot for both retirees and remote workers, offering Atlantic access at more moderate price points than its southern neighbors.

The smaller communities of Fellsmere, Florida Ridge, and Gifford represent the county's most affordable markets, yet even these areas have experienced significant appreciation due to proximity to the coast and limited inventory. Orchid Island, despite its small size, commands attention as one of the most exclusive barrier island communities on the entire East Coast, with properties rarely changing hands and creating intense competition when they do become available.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Indian River County's real estate market operates on fascinating micro-dynamics, where properties just miles apart can differ by millions in value based on water access, elevation, and community amenities. The county's position between more populous Brevard and St. Lucie counties creates unique opportunities for buyers seeking coastal access without metropolitan density, while sellers benefit from scarcity-driven appreciation that has outpaced many Florida markets over the past decade.

Seasonal fluctuations here are more pronounced than in year-round Florida markets, with winter months bringing an influx of northeastern buyers who often make quick decisions on properties they've identified during brief visits. This creates a fast-moving market where local knowledge and immediate responsiveness are crucial, particularly for properties with water access or those in gated communities with limited inventory.
